If you reduce overstriding by 8 cm and increase projection by 8 cm, it appears that nothing changed with step length, but the net improvement is huge. Like body composition, you can gain 10 pounds of muscle and strip 10 pounds of fat, but the scale is not a true metric.

NEW PAPER 🏈 Kinetics & Kinematics of Initial Accel 🏃‍♂️💨 Key findings: 🔋Pmax largest relationship w/ 10m performance 💪F0 more important as body mass increases ✅Kinematics associated w/ higher levels of Pmax described @JSportsSci 👇🏼 tandfonline.com/eprint/UJBPHFZ…
